What is the cheapest cable TV provider?

Cheapest cable plans

Provider and Plan Price Number of Channels
Xfinity: Choice Limited TV $30/month 10+
Charter Spectrum TV Select $44.99/month for 12 months 125+
Mediacom: Internet 60 + Local TV $49.99/month for 12 months 50+ channels and internet speeds up to 60 Mbps
RCN: Signature TV $59.99/month for 12 months 291+

What can I use instead of a cable box?

Alternatives to the Cable Box

  • Instead of having boxes for all your TVs, you can opt to keep the cable on your main TV and consider using an antenna to receive programming on one more of your additional TVs.
  • If any of your TVs is a Smart TV, you can access movies and TV shows via internet streaming.

    How to watch local network channels without cable?

    HD antenna. We recommend the ClearStream Eclipse or Vansky antenna. An HD antenna is especially perfect for those who want a traditional TV experience.

  • Channel app. The second way to watch local channels without cable is getting a subscription to a specific channel’s app.
  • Live TV streaming app. A popular solution to cutting the cord is subscribing to a live TV streaming service.
  • Live stream local news online. If local news is what you’re looking for,then the fourth way to watch local channels without cable is simply watching the live stream
  • YouTube. And for the last and final way to watch local channels without cable: YouTube,the online video-sharing platform.
